Liability

If you've suffered injuries in an accident with a truck it is crucial to find an attorney who has the experience needed to negotiate effectively with insurance companies. A knowledgeable and caring lawyer by your side will reduce the stress.

A good New York City truck accident lawyer will investigate your case thoroughly to determine what caused the accident and who is responsible. They will also be able determine the cause of the crash and gather evidence to support your claim.

There are several parties that could be held accountable for a truck crash which include the driver, trucking company, and truck manufacturer. In addition, the shipper may be held accountable for improper loading of their cargo, or a city could be held accountable for not adequately maintaining streets.

The liability of the trucking company can be increased if the driver was drunk or intoxicated, driving or engaged in other reckless behavior that led to the collision. The company's supervisors are also accountable for making sure that drivers have a clean driving record and are competent to operate the vehicle safely.

The trucking company can also be held responsible for negligent maintenance. If the truck was not maintained in a timely manner the trucking firm could be liable for any damages resulting from the repair or replacement of damaged parts.

Another possibility of potential liability is a business that created a defective item in the truck. If the manufacturer failed to spot a defect in a critical component in the truck, they may be held responsible for any damage that occurred as a result of the failure.

Assessing the truck at crash site is one of the first steps that an attorney for truck accidents will take to determine who's responsible. This involves evaluating the damage to the truck, and then inspecting it for any mechanical problems or defects.

If the truck is fitted with a "blackbox," it may provide important information about the condition of the truck at time of the accident. The information can be used by your lawyer to determine who was accountable for the accident and the amount of compensation you are entitled to.

Expert Witnesses

Expert witnesses can be essential to the outcome of a truck accident case. They can assist in establishing the liability, as well as determine damages, share technical knowledge and boost the credibility of your argument.

The initial type of expert witness a truck accident lawyer might need is an expert in reconstruction. These experts are trained to analyze the physical evidence that is found at the scene of the accident, and using their findings to reconstruct the incident and identify who was at fault.

Skid marks, road debris and other evidence are often scrutinized to determine the cause of an accident happened. They can also examine the "black box" information on the vehicle of the driver to determine whether he was speeding up or distracted at the time of the accident.

They can also look over maintenance records and black-box information from the trucking firm to determine if it was in compliance with safety regulations that could have prevented this incident. They can also examine the truck to see whether it had any issues that could have led to a breakdown, such as an inefficient tire.

Medical experts are another type of expert witness that lawyers for truck accidents may employ. These experts are adept at treating injured people and know the effects of a crash on their bodies. They can provide evidence of how the injuries sustained from the accident affected your quality of life and how long it will continue to affect you in the future.

An expert in economics can help you prove your losses. They can provide the amount of your medical bills, loss of income, and other financial losses. This is essential in proving that the damages you sustained were significant and proportional to the cause of your accident.

Time Limits

There are a myriad of laws that govern trucking operations, including regulations on a driver's maximum driving hours, mandatory medical exams and drug testing. These rules are a bit complicated, so if you have been involved in a trucking crash and you are injured, you should consult an experienced attorney to protect your rights.

If you are planning to bring an action in New York for damages after an accident involving a truck accident law firm, time is of the most crucial aspect. The state has strict laws and statutes of limitation that limit the time in which you must file a lawsuit.

The most important rule to adhere to is to act fast and speak with an attorney as early as you can. Waiting too long can cause your case to be weaker, resulting in a less favorable settlement. It can also cause evidence to be lost for example, the memory of a witness regarding the incident.

The statute of limitations in New york for personal injury claims is 3 years. This is a strict deadline and you'll need to provide your attorney with all the details regarding your case before time runs out.

There are also other laws and regulations that may influence your ability to recover damages following a trucking accident in the state of New York. For instance in the event that the truck that caused your crash was owned or operated by a public agency (like the NY Sanitation Department for accidents caused by garbage trucks) you must provide notice to that agency before filing your claim.
